Testing a smartwatch to record heart rhythms
Part of Heart & circulation clinical trials.
This study is testing whether a connected watch (like a smartwatch) can accurately record your heart's electrical activity (an ECG) during a hospital stay or clinic visit. If it works well, it could make checking your heart easier and more convenient.

Who can take part
- You are currently in the hospital or visiting a cardiology clinic at Haut Lévêque hospital.
- You can be any age—from a newborn baby to an adult.
- You (or a parent, if you are a minor) must agree in writing to take part in the study.
- You must have health insurance coverage (social security).
- You are able to give your own consent, or your legal guardian can do it for you.
